Noblesville residents typically run into defective auto part situations in patterns tied to daily driving—stop-and-go traffic, seasonal weather shifts, and frequent highway merges.
Common scenarios we investigate include:
- Brake performance problems that appear after commuting routes with repeated hard stops
- Traction/tire issues that worsen during winter freeze-thaw cycles and wet conditions
- Steering or suspension malfunctions that feel “wrong” at highway speeds or during sudden lane changes
- Electrical or warning-system failures that create intermittent safety risks (and confusing diagnostic stories)
- Airbag or restraint-related concerns after a collision where the vehicle’s safety systems did not perform as expected
Even when a vehicle is later repaired, there may still be recoverable evidence—diagnostic codes, inspection notes, parts history, and documentation from before repairs.
